Odisha Sarpanch Declares 72-Hour Shutdown After Migrant Tests Corona Positive

Patna: Sarpanch of Jamunapashi panchayat under Patna block in Keonjhar district has declared  72-hour shutdown in the panchayat after a migrant lodged at Biseipat High School quarantine centre tested positive for COVID-19.

Sarpanch Mamatamayee Nayak announced that the shutdown rules will be strictly imposed in six villages -Yamunapashi, Barudipashi, Godipokhari, Padmapur, Padmakesharpur and Kodakhman – of the panchayat.

“No shops or markets will be opened during the period,” she added.
